Question

What is the main component of Peregal O-10?

The main component of Peregal O-10 is fatty alcohol polyoxyethylene ether (C12-14 alcohol polyoxyethylene ether, 10 EO), which is a non-ionic surfactant.

Detailed Description

The chemical nature of Peregal O-10 is fatty alcohol polyoxyethylene ether, specifically a condensation product of C12-14 alcohols with ethylene oxide (EO), with an average ethylene oxide addition number of 10 moles. Its CAS number is 68439-49-6, and its systematic name can be written as C12-14 alcohol ethoxylate-10 or C12-14 alcohol polyoxyethylene ether (10 mol EO).

This product is manufactured by using natural or synthetic C12-C14 fatty alcohols as starting materials, which react with ethylene oxide under a catalyst through an addition reaction. In the molecular structure, the hydrophobic alkyl chain (R-) of the fatty alcohol provides lipophilicity, while the polyoxyethylene chain segment (-(CH₂CH₂O)₁₀-H) imparts hydrophilicity. This amphiphilic structure, with one end lipophilic and the other hydrophilic, enables it to effectively reduce the interfacial tension between oil and water, performing various functions such as emulsification, wetting, dispersing, and solubilization.

As a typical non-ionic surfactant, Peregal O-10 does not ionize in aqueous solutions, thus exhibiting good chemical stability, resistance to acids, alkalis, and hard water, and does not form precipitates with metal ions. It can be widely used with anionic, cationic, and amphoteric surfactants for synergistic effects.

Technical Parameters

ParameterValue
Chemical NameFatty alcohol polyoxyethylene ether
CAS No.68439-49-6
Product TypeNon-ionic surfactant
Hydrophobic GroupC12-C14 fatty alcohol
EO Addition NumberApprox. 10 mol
IonicityNon-ionic

Application Recommendations

With its molecular structure of C12-14 alcohol and 10 EO, Peregal O-10 has a moderate HLB value, offering good emulsifying power and wetting penetration. It is widely used in: textile dyeing leveling agents, industrial and household cleaning agents, pesticide emulsifiers, cosmetic cream and lotion emulsifiers, and wetting and dispersing agents in coatings and inks, among other fields.

Precautions

  • The product is classified under GHS07, may cause skin irritation (H315) and eye irritation (H319). Wear protective gloves and goggles when handling.
  • Recommended storage temperature is 10°C to 35°C, avoid high temperatures and freezing conditions, keep container tightly closed.
